Stephen Vinson Acheson, 51, of Burkburnett, passed away Friday, March 13, 2020.

A Celebration of Life will be held at 7:00 p.m. Tuesday, March 17, 2020 in the chapel of Owens & Brumley Funeral Home in Burkburnett. The funeral liturgy will be celebrated at 1:00 p.m. Wednesday, March 18, 2020 at St. Jude Catholic Church in Burkburnett with Rev. Khoi Tran, celebrant. Arrangements are under the direction of Owens & Brumley Funeral Home in Burkburnett.

Steve was born June 20, 1968 in Flint, Michigan to Donald and Juliana (Guerra) Acheson. He was a 1986 graduate of Burkburnett High School, and went on to serve our country in the United States Army. Steve was a real people person and a friend to everyone he met. He loved watching football, listening and dancing to country music, and he loved his family.

He was preceded in death by his father, Donald Acheson; and his younger brother, Jeremy Acheson.

He is survived by his girlfriend, Becky Hernandez of Wichita Falls; his mother, Julia Acheson of Burkburnett; his children, Chase Moore and wife Sarah of Albuquerque, New Mexico, Cameron Moore and wife Rachel of Mississippi, Savanah Acheson Mass and husband Kody of Wichita Falls, Coby Acheson and wife Lexi of Wichita Falls, and Katie Hefner and husband Kirby of El Paso; his sisters and brothers, Michelle Gann and husband Randy of Burkburnett, Ronald Acheson and wife Rhianna of Wichita Falls, Jennifer Lichtenberger and husband Kurt of Wichita Falls, his twin sister, Stephanie Marshall and husband Paul of Iowa Park, Briana Burke and husband Christopher of Keller, Jason Acheson and Erik Acheson both of Burkburnett; eight grandchildren and several nieces, nephews, family and friends.
